SAFETY SPECIALIST - 12 Months Fixed Term

Gladstone Ports Corporation (GPC), a leading Government Owned Corporation (GOC), manages four key port precincts: Port of Gladstone, Port of Rockhampton, Port of Bundaberg, and Port of Maryborough.

Our dual operating model, including both port and coal terminals, positions us as a premier multi-commodity port operator.

We are committed to efficient, effective, and environmentally responsible operations, fostering growth and prosperity for Queensland. With our deepwater port, strategic land holdings, and proximity to Asia, GPC is poised to capitalise on globalisation, new energy, and technological advancements.

About the Role

We are seeking a highly skilled and qualified Safety Specialist to join our team on a 12-month fixed-term contract. This critical role is responsible for managing GPC's drug and alcohol program, occupational hygiene portfolio, and fire safety systems, ensuring compliance with industry standards and legislative requirements.

Key Responsibilities

  • Coordinate and manage GPC's occupational hygiene management program including conducting occupational hygiene surveillance activities and providing technical advice to ensure the hygiene management system remains fit for purpose and achieves compliance;

  • Quality assurance and reporting of GPC's occupational hygiene surveillance program;

  • Coordinate GPC's fire safety management system, including performing the role of Fire Safety Advisor in accordance with legislation;

  • Facilitate the drug and alcohol testing contract and random testing regimes;

  • Conduct internal audit programs in collaboration with the Safety & Environment Systems Lead to ensure compliance with safety management system and ISO45001 requirements;

  • Conduct assurance activities, including safety interactions, audits and verifications;

  • Undertake and participate in projects and business improvements as directed and in accordance with Safety Business Plan;

  • Contribute to the design and delivery of training programs related to Safety hygiene, monitoring and assurance;

Mandatory Requirements:

  • Certificate IV in Work Health and Safety (or similar).

  • Fire Safety Advisor qualification.

Desirable Qualifications:

  • Tertiary Qualification in Occupational Health and Safety, Audit, or Assurance.

  • Certification in AIOH Basic Principles of Occupational Hygiene.

  • Competencies in respirable dust monitoring (e.g., BSBWHS409 Respirable Dust Monitoring, Monitoring Respirable Dust in Coal Mines, Minerals, and Quarries).
